On reviewing the evidence on King Tutankhamun, it is clear that he died in a chariot accident while hunting. There are four pieces of evidence that have been outlined in order to prove that King Tutankhamun died in a hunting accident. Firstly, there are hunting weapons, chariot, and armor in the tomb.Secondly, there was a garland on Tutankhamun’s mummy that consisted of flowers that come into bloom in the months of March to April, shortly after the hunting season.Thirdly, Tutankhamun might have been attacked while hunting a hippo as there are broken ribs on his mummy. The Many Theories Behind the Death of King Tut Tutankhamun’s tomb is considered to be one of the greatest archeological finds of our time, but perhaps what makes King Tut even more appealing is the most widely debated mystery of the young pharaoh’s life-his death. The tomb of King Tut was discovered by Egyptologist Howard Carter and his financial backer Lord Carnarvon on November 4, 1922; on November 11, 1925, a team led by anatomist Douglas Derry and Howard Carter performed what was to be the first of several examinations on the body of King Tut.     Tutankhamun’s breathtaking funerary mask is made of solid gold with decorations in carnelian, lapis lazuli, turquoise and glass paste. The composition of the piece is based on classical canons, while the slightly elongated oval of the face, the almond-shaped eyes set beneath arched brows, the slim graceful nose, and the mouth with its full, soft lips reveal the influence of innovation that fleetingly appeared in Egyptian art during the reign of Akhenaten.…

    King Tutankhamen was a pharaoh who died at a young age and is rumored to have a cursed tomb. Tut was a young boy when he came into power in Egypt in 1332 BC. His decade long rule was relatively insignificant in Egyptian history, but the discovery of his tomb in 1922 was among the most remarkable events of time. Discovered by British Archaeologist, Howard Carter, King Tut’s tomb was the first tomb to be found almost entirely intact.
